MR. BUNGLE – Dead Goon

Mr. Bungle's self-titled debut album was released on August 13, 1991, through Warner Bros. Records. Mike Patton managed to get his band hired by the major label after he became the vocalist for Faith No More. TUB RING – Faster / Bite The Wax Tadpole

Tub Ring is a Chicago-based band formed in 1992 by Jason Fields, Kevin Gibson, Chris "Mouse" Blake, and Geoff Valker. After the passing of their manager, Lee Swanson in 1994, the band lineup changed and took form with the addition of keyboardist Rob Kleiner.
